AI is speeding up digital forensics, but speed without control is how good labs get burned. We dig into a safer way to work: use AI-assisted coding to generate a repeatable process, then test it against a real corpus of known extractions so results stay deterministic, verifiable, and defensible. If you’ve ever felt your LLM results “drift” from run to run, this mindset shift is the difference between a helpful assistant and a hidden liability.
We also get practical with what’s new across the community: a free macOS timestamp utility, Android intrusion logs (and how to extract and parse them when a user has opted in), and a deep look at Apple Unified Logs and log archives as an underrated iOS forensics goldmine. The big takeaway on logs is interpretation: one scary-looking line is not a conclusion. You have to read the surrounding sequence of events to avoid false narratives, and we talk about how newer workflows can process log archives directly from extractions without requiring a Mac.
From there we move into evidence sources that often decide cases: iOS Health database artifacts, LevelDB and IndexedDB for browser forensics, and a standout BitLocker improvement that can auto-unlock secondary encrypted volumes when keys are preserved in a system image. Finally, we walk through reporting at scale with LAVA, the LEAPPs viewer that adds conversation views, analytics, tagging, notes, and LAVA subset exports for massive chats that would otherwise choke HTML reports.

Android Intrusion Logs And ALeapp Parser
SPEAKER_00So Christian Peter, uh, he put out a new blog and updates to his Android logical extractor tool, otherwise known as Alex. Um he he now grabs the Android intrusion logs. So Android intrusion logs are an opt-in forensic log on Android devices, started with Android 16. And what it does is it records device and network activities that help investigate uh potential spyware attacks, I guess. Did I get all that right? Yeah. So so Christian Peters uh Alex tool now will um extract those from your device, from your Android device. And Kevin Pagano actually created a parser for them in A Leap as well. So if you're able to get those, if your user has opted in, uh extraction is really easy and parsing is really easy. Because it's supportive.

AIM BitLocker Auto-Unlock Breakthrough
SPEAKER_00so there was also an update to Arsenal Image Mounter. Um, one of the new features in Arsenal Image Mounter is BitLocker auto unlock, and I'm gonna show a little video on that too. Um, but auto unlock for auxiliary volumes as well. Windows can store auto-unlock keys for secondary BitLocker encrypted drives that a computer has been authorized to access. So, from a forensic perspective, Arsenal Image Mounter can identify those keys in an acquired system volume and use them when the corresponding encrypted drive image is mounted. So, for example, you might have an encrypted USB or an external hard drive where you don't know the recovery password. But if that computer was previously configured to automatically unlock it, the necessary key may already exist in the forensic image. So AIM can recognize that relationship and automatically unlock that secondary volume. Um, so let me let me show a little video on this.

One one that's really I want to highlight is the biome slash segb files. If you're not familiar with the biome directory and the seg files, segb files within it, you have to go look at the different episodes, go into leaps.org, go anywhere, look at Chris Vance's stuff from Magnet about biomes, you need to be familiar with it. We added 36 different modules or segB data points. And I believe that we the iOS, the iLeap, you know, for you know, the lead for iOS, we are the tooling that has the most segB files in the biome support there is, period. If you want to look at biomes, thanks to Mattia and other researchers that added to that, we have the most biome uh directory artifacts in existence in a tool, and there's more, there's more coming out all times, right? So we'll continue to grow that with further research. So you want to look at and if you're like, I have no idea what BRICS is talking about. Well, let me give you a quick synopsis, a one-sentence synopsis. Biome that the biome directory contains seg B data that within it has pattern of life activity, pattern of life, and that's all you need to know. If you're trying to uh look at what the device was doing at certain points and how that relates to user activity, that's where you need to be. This is the the successor of the a lot of the knowledge C data or data streams that used to live in that database, now they live inside B uh uh streams within the biome directory.
